Understanding the Root of Lower Back Pain

Lower back pain can stem from many causes, including:

  • Poor posture

  • Muscle strain

  • Herniated or bulging discs

  • Degenerative disc disease

  • Sciatica

  • Joint dysfunction

  • Sedentary lifestyle or repetitive motion

Chiropractors focus on identifying the underlying source of pain rather than simply masking the symptoms. This approach allows for a more effective and lasting recovery.

1. Spinal Adjustments (Chiropractic Manipulations)

This is the foundation of chiropractic care. A spinal adjustment involves applying a controlled, precise force to a joint in the spine that is not moving properly. These misalignments — known as subluxations — can irritate surrounding nerves and muscles, leading to pain and inflammation.

Benefits of spinal adjustments include:

  • Restored mobility in the spine

  • Decreased muscle tension

  • Improved nerve function

  • Reduced inflammation

  • Faster healing

Patients often experience immediate relief after an adjustment, though multiple sessions may be necessary depending on the severity and cause of the pain.

2. Flexion-Distraction Technique

This gentle, hands-on technique is especially useful for treating herniated or bulging discs. It involves a specialized table that moves in a rhythmic motion while the chiropractor applies pressure to stretch and decompress the spine.

Why it works:

  • Reduces pressure on spinal discs

  • Increases spinal motion

  • Promotes nutrient exchange within the discs

  • Helps relieve leg pain related to sciatica

This is a safe, non-force method that many patients find relaxing and highly effective.

3. Trigger Point Therapy & Soft Tissue Work

Muscle knots and tightness in the lower back can contribute to pain and limit movement. Mount Logan Chiropractic partners with expert massage therapists in Logan who use manual techniques to release tension in these areas.

Soft tissue therapies may include:

  • Manual massage

  • Trigger point release

  • Myofascial release

These techniques help improve circulation, break up scar tissue, and restore range of motion in the affected muscles.
